Abstract
An improved breakaway coupling is provided which is particularly suitable for use in assemblies which are subject to impact such as roadway lamp standards, highway signs and the like. A number of longitudinal grooves provide fracture-initiating regions which provide relatively high compressive and tensile strength in a fracturable coupling.

BACKGROUND AND SUMMARY OF THE INVENTION

Several varieties of breakaway couplings are known for the support of light standards, signs, parking meters, and the like. Some of these couplings or connectors are shown in U.S. Pat. Nos. 3,630,474; 3,572,223; 3,349,531 and 3,521,413, the teachings of which are herewith incorporated by reference thereto. Such breakaway connectors or couplings desirably fail readily when the supported structure is subjected to lateral impact such as may be applied by a colliding automobile. However, the coupling must have substantial tensile and compressive strength. Yet such couplings desirably fail under the impact force in such a manner as to substantially reduce accident severity to motorists who are sufficiently unfortunate to be closely involved with the failure of such a coupling. Many breakaway coupling devices employ a shear or sliding mode of crack propagation; i.e., one surface of the ruptured coupling slides over another surface of the coupling during the impact failure process.
